    I'm a 10man healer who heals Spine as Holy, but I figure I can still share a few words anyways.

    Renew is a wonderful thing for this fight. I would say go for Divine Touch and Rapid Renewal. If I were you, I would drop Inspiration if you have a Resto Shaman in the raid. I can understand the validity of using SoR and Blessed Resil for this fight, so it's your choice where you'd drop the one last point from to get Rapid Renewal (between Darkness, SoR, and Blessed Resil). This is actually one of the few fights I would love to have SoR on, since I usually tend to die towards the end of the fight Gotta love healing aggro while already fading on CD (and having Fade glyphed -.-) One thing though is I notice you don't have Body and Soul. I was going to drop it for this fight initially, until I realized it's quite useful for when the tank is kiting the adds.

    Also, I prefer to use Burning Shadowspirit Diamond personally as the meta gem, might be something you'd want to consider. Also putting +65 mastery onto gloves (versus your +50) would be a small enchant improvement.

    Yes, this for sure, it's something I didn't realize until about a month and a half ago. If you look at your logs carefully, you'll find that 3% larger crits is about 1% additional throughput. As holy if you consider replen and arcane torrent, the extra mana from a 2% larger manapool and the extra active regen that brings only equals one extra PoH for most fights. Two on spine. It's worth considerably less than 0.5% HPS.
